Abbie Eads
Abbie Eads, Assistant Lecturer
Abbie Eads is a conductor and cellist celebrated for her clarity, collaborative spirit, and dynamic artistry. Equally at ease with orchestras, choirs, instrumentalists, singers, and musical theater, she inspires audiences with performances that balance tradition and innovation. Her career reflects a versatility that bridges classical, contemporary, and cross-genre projects, including a recent recording with Sony Music Publishing artists Raynes, produced by Grammy-winning engineer Chris Sclafani, known for his work with artists like Ed Sheeran, Justin Bieber, Selena Gomez, The Weeknd, and Ariana Grande.
She has held leadership positions as Conductor-in-Residence with the NW Edvard Grieg Society, Director of Orchestras at Pierce College, and Director of Music at Our Lady of the Lake Parish in Seattle. She holds a Master’s in Orchestral Conducting from the University of Washington and a Bachelor of Arts in Music from Minot State University.
